Pearland weather in December

In December, Pearland sees average daytime highs of 65°F and overnight lows near 48°F, with 4.0 in of precipitation across 9.3 wet days and about 10.1 hours of daylight. It is the 11th-warmest and 4th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s ease over the month, from about 67°F in the first days to 63°F by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 32% of the time in December,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 10 h 12 min at the start of December to 10 h 06 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, December is Pearland's 11th-clearest and 6th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Pearland's year-round climate.

Temperature in December

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s ease over the month, from about 67°F in the first days to 63°F by the end.

A typical December day in Pearland reaches about 65°F in the afternoon and slips back to 48°F overnight — a 17°F sp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 52°F and 76°F. Set against its neighbours, December runs about 7°F cooler than November and about 2°F warmer than January.

Location & terrain

Where is Pearland?

Pearland sits at 29.6°N, 95.3°W, 49 ft above sea level, in United States. The nearest listed city is Friendswood, 5.6 mi away.

Topography around Pearland

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 2, 10 and 50 miles of Pearland.

Within 2 miles, the terrain around Pearland has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 59 ft around an average of 49 ft above sea level; within 10 miles,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 121 ft; within 50 miles,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 322 ft.

The land around Pearland is covered by trees (37%), artificial surfaces (30%) and grassland (28%) within 2 miles, trees (42%), grassland (29%) and artificial surfaces (24%) within 10 miles, and trees (34%), grassland (24%) and water (21%) within 50 miles.
